YSL L'Homme, launched in 2006, is more than just a fragrance; it's a statement. A sophisticated, subtly seductive scent that has solidified its place as a classic in the world of men's perfumery. Created by the masterful noses of Anne Flipo, Pierre Wargnye, and Dominique Ropion, this Woody Floral Musk fragrance has captivated men for years, earning its place within the prestigious YSL L'Homme collection and garnering a dedicated following. This exploration dives deep into the nuances of YSL L'Homme Eau de Toilette, examining its composition, its place within the broader YSL fragrance landscape, its price points, and its enduring appeal.
A Symphony of Scents: Deconstructing the Fragrance
YSL L'Homme Eau de Toilette doesn't rely on brash, overwhelming notes. Instead, it presents a carefully balanced composition that unfolds gradually, revealing its complexity over time. The opening is a vibrant burst of freshness, typically attributed to the top notes. While the exact proportions are kept closely guarded by YSL, common descriptions point to a blend of invigorating citrus notes, possibly bergamot and lemon, offering a clean, zesty introduction. This initial brightness is quickly softened by the heart notes, where the floral and spicy elements come into play. Violet, often cited as a key player, provides a powdery sweetness that prevents the fragrance from being overly sharp. This floral heart is further nuanced by subtle spicy undertones, adding a layer of warmth and intrigue without overpowering the overall delicate balance.
As the fragrance settles, the base notes emerge, revealing the woody and musky foundation that gives L'Homme its distinctive character. Cedarwood, a classic choice for masculine fragrances, provides a grounding woody aroma, while the musk adds a smooth, sensual quality. This base is often described as warm and slightly powdery, creating a lingering impression that is both sophisticated and inviting. The overall effect is a fragrance that is simultaneously fresh and warm, classic and contemporary, making it versatile enough for a range of occasions. Its subtle complexity rewards those who take the time to appreciate its evolution throughout the day.
The YSL L'Homme Collection: A Legacy of Masculinity
YSL L'Homme Eau de Toilette is not an isolated creation; it is the cornerstone of a successful fragrance line. The YSL L'Homme collection has expanded over the years, offering various flankers that build upon the original's success while exploring different facets of masculinity. These variations often introduce new notes and accords, broadening the appeal to a wider range of tastes. Some flankers retain the core DNA of the original, offering subtle twists and adjustments, while others venture into bolder, more experimental territory. This range allows consumers to discover the fragrance profile that best suits their individual preferences, all while benefiting from the consistent quality and craftsmanship associated with the YSL brand.
The expansion of the L'Homme collection also demonstrates the enduring appeal of the original Eau de Toilette. Its success has paved the way for further exploration within the same olfactory family, proving the versatility and timelessness of its core composition. This collection showcases YSL's commitment to providing a diverse range of options for men who appreciate sophisticated and refined fragrances.
